Stationary Configurations of Point Vortices (Morse Theory, Hamiltonian Systems, Fluid Mechanics)
Abstract
dc:descriptionThe motion of point vortices in a plane of fluid is an old problem of fluid mechanics, which was given a Hamiltonian formulation by Kirchhoff. Stationary configurations are those which remain self-similar throughout the motion, and are of considerable physical interest.
